3-methyl-4-phenyl-1,2-oxazol-5-amine

Description:
3-Methyl-4-phenyl-1,2-oxazol-5-amine is an organic compound characterized by its oxazole ring, which is a five-membered heterocyclic structure containing both nitrogen and oxygen atoms. This compound features a methyl group and a phenyl group, contributing to its unique chemical properties and potential biological activity. The presence of the amine functional group indicates that it can participate in hydrogen bonding, influencing its solubility and reactivity. Formula:C10H10N2O
InChI:InChI=1/C10H10N2O/c1-7-9(10(11)13-12-7)8-5-3-2-4-6-8/h2-6H,11H2,1H3
SMILES:Cc1c(c2ccccc2)c(N)on1
Synonyms:
  • 5-Isoxazolamine, 3-Methyl-4-Phenyl-
